Understanding Cast Sand


Cast sand, often referred to as foundry sand, is a high-quality silica sand suitable for metal casting processes. The sand is specifically selected for its shape, size, and purity to ensure that it can withstand the high temperatures involved in casting molten metal. The two primary types of cast sand are green sand—often a mixture of sand, clay, and water—and resin-coated sand, which provides superior durability and surface finish.

Influential Factors in the Export Market


Several factors impact the dynamics of the cast sand export market


- Quality Standards The demand for high-quality cast sand has led to the imposition of strict quality standards. Exporters must meet international specifications to remain competitive, which may involve investment in newer technologies and production methods.


- Environmental Regulations Growing environmental concerns have prompted many countries to enforce regulations concerning mining and processing silica sand. Exporters need to adapt their practices to comply with these standards, which may affect production costs and availability.


- Market Demand The cyclical nature of the manufacturing industry influences the demand for cast sand. Economic downturns can lead to reduced production in sectors that rely heavily on metal casting, subsequently affecting exports.


- Logistics and Transportation The ability to efficiently transport cast sand products to international markets plays a crucial role in maintaining competitive advantage. Exporters must navigate logistical challenges, including shipping costs and infrastructure limitations.
